Abstract

The complex task of efficient operation of a power system and load despatching has necessitated the use of telemetry and telecontrol systems for this purpose. Conventional telemetry systems based on digital cyclic techniques have limitations in terms of processing capacity, operational flexibility, diagnostics and data security. The advent of microprocessors have made the present day telemetry and telecontrol systems intelligent and sophisticated. Microprocessor based telemetry units can acquire data, process it and transmit to and fro from the load despatch centre with a high degree of security.A typical telemetry and telecontrol system for load despatch application comprises computer based master control system at load despatch centre, a set of microprocessor based remote terminal units (RTU's) placed at various power generating stations/substations anda suitable communication link between master control system and remote units.This paper brings out the functional requirements of a telemetry/telecontrol system for electrical load despatch application.
